独立站页面加载超5秒?7个适合Google SEO的加速方案
随着互联网的发展,用户对于网站访问的速度要求越来越高。如果你的独立站页面加载时间超过5秒,不仅会影响用户体验,还可能导致网站排名下降,甚至流失潜在客户。根据Google的数据显示,页面加载时间每增加一秒,可能导致转化率下降7%。因此,确保网站加载速度是提高SEO排名和用户满意度的关键。本文将为你介绍7个适合Google SEO的页面加速方案,帮助你提高独立站的加载速度,提升搜索引擎排名。
1. 优化图片大小和格式
图片是页面加载缓慢的主要原因之一,尤其是在视觉内容丰富的网站中。对于独立站来说,优化图片的大小和格式是提升加载速度的首要步骤。建议使用以下技巧:
压缩图片:使用工具如TinyPNG、ImageOptim对图片进行压缩,减少图片文件大小,但不牺牲图片质量。
使用现代格式:如WebP格式,它比传统的JPG或PNG格式更加高效,能够提供更小的文件大小,同时保持较好的图片质量。
懒加载技术:通过懒加载(Lazy Loading)技术,只有在用户滚动到页面的特定部分时才加载图片,从而加速页面初始加载时间。
2. 启用浏览器缓存
浏览器缓存是提高网页加载速度的另一种有效方法。它能让用户在访问页面时保存一部分静态资源(如图片、JS和CSS文件),当用户再次访问时,这些资源就不需要重新下载,从而节省了加载时间。
设置缓存过期时间:可以通过修改服务器的缓存头,确保静态资源在一定时间内不需要重新加载。
使用版本控制:当你更新页面内容或静态资源时,确保通过修改资源的文件名或版本号来强制浏览器加载最新的文件。
3. 使用内容分发网络(CDN)
CDN(内容分发网络)是一组分布在全球的服务器,能够将你的网站内容缓存并分发到离用户最近的服务器上。使用CDN可以显著减少服务器响应时间,提高页面加载速度,尤其是在全球范围内有大量访问者时。
选择合适的CDN供应商:例如Cloudflare、Amazon CloudFront或KeyCDN等,选择一个离你的目标用户群体近的CDN服务商。
合理配置CDN:确保所有静态资源(如CSS、JS、图片等)都通过CDN进行分发,而动态内容则根据需要调整缓存策略。
4. 减少HTTP请求
每次用户访问你的独立站时,浏览器会向服务器发出多个HTTP请求,加载页面中的各种资源,如图片、CSS、JS等。减少HTTP请求的数量是加速页面加载的关键。
合并CSS和JS文件:将多个CSS和JavaScript文件合并成一个文件,减少请求次数。
使用图标字体替代图片:例如使用FontAwesome图标字体替代传统的图片图标,可以减少HTTP请求。
采用内联方式:对于一些小的CSS或JS,可以考虑将其直接内联到HTML中,避免单独请求文件。
5. 优化服务器响应时间
服务器响应时间过长是导致页面加载缓慢的另一个原因。提高服务器响应速度能有效提升页面加载时间,从而改善用户体验。
选择高性能的主机:确保你的服务器能够处理大量请求,选择一个响应速度快且稳定的主机服务提供商。
使用PHP优化:如果你使用的是PHP网站,优化PHP代码,避免过多的数据库查询和冗长的处理过程。
数据库优化:定期清理和优化数据库,减少冗余数据和无效查询,提升数据库响应速度。
6. 启用Gzip压缩
Gzip压缩可以将网站的HTML、CSS、JavaScript等文本文件进行压缩,从而减小文件的大小,加速页面加载。大部分现代浏览器都支持Gzip压缩,因此启用Gzip压缩是提升网站性能的有效手段。
启用服务器端压缩:在Apache或Nginx服务器上启用Gzip压缩,确保页面加载时能快速传输压缩后的文件。
检查压缩效果:使用工具如Google PageSpeed Insights检查网站是否已经启用了Gzip压缩。
7. 精简和优化代码
冗余的代码不仅浪费带宽,还会拖慢网页加载速度。精简和优化HTML、CSS、JavaScript等代码,能够减少文件的体积,提升页面加载速度。
删除无用的代码:移除不必要的注释、空格和换行符,使代码更加简洁。
压缩代码:使用工具如CSS Minifier、JavaScript Minifier压缩CSS和JS文件,减少文件大小。
异步加载JS:对于非关键的JavaScript文件,使用异步加载方式,避免它们阻塞页面的渲染。
结语:提高页面加载速度,助力SEO排名
网站页面加载速度与SEO排名密切相关,Google已经明确表示,页面加载时间是影响排名的因素之一。通过优化图片、使用CDN、启用浏览器缓存、减少HTTP请求等措施,你可以有效提升独立站的加载速度,进而提升用户体验和搜索引擎排名。这些措施不仅能提高页面加载速度,还能提升站点的整体性能,吸引更多的访客和潜在客户。